A balloon is filled with 0.400 moles of gas. How many liters of gas at STP were pumped into the balloon?
Fynjy0 [20]

Answer:

8.96 L

Explanation:

At STP, 1 mole = 22.4 L

0.400 mole *   (22.4 L. /1 mole of gas) = 8.96 L

When rearranging the formula for density, mass is equal to:?
Jet001 [13]
Mass equals density times volume
Because D=m/v
Multiply by v
Dv=m
